The Warwick Daily News Lifeline Bookfest is being held on Friday 18 May and Saturday 19 May. Proudly sponsored by the Warwick Daily News since 1989 the Warwick Bookfest is one of Lifeline Darling Downs & South West QLD'S major fundraisers. All proceeds raised from the event go towards their crisis support and suicide prevention services in this region. There will hundreds of donated books on sale with nothing over $5.00 with many much less. Doors open Friday 3pm- 8pm and Saturday 8am – 2pm at St Mary’s Hall, Cnr Wood Street and Acacia Avenue, Warwick. There’s free admission, free parking and Eftpos available, so why not pop along and stock up on your reading material for winter!
